AttorneyAtWar Posted April 2, 2015 Share Posted April 2, 2015 (edited) No. Should i have ? Yes, you should have launched the base game first, and once you have, there is a specific order that you need to patch and install expansions in. I recommend you completely uninstall the game, than install it again and run it at least once. Having done that, go to the Shock Force store page and find the "patches" section, there it will tell you what patches you are going to need to install and in what order with the expansions. Edit: Make sure you launch the game at least once after every patch/expansion you install. Edited April 2, 2015 by Raptorx7 1 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

agusto Posted April 2, 2015 Share Posted April 2, 2015 (edited) I have Win 7 64 bit and every CM games works fine for me - i have never had any Windows related problems. I suspect that one of the following may cause your problems: a) your drivers are out of date or are not installed. your windows is not up to date. c) you did not install the patches and modules in the correct order. It is a bit complicated, but AFAIK you must follow it to the letter to get everything to work. d) your antivirus is causing a conflict - CMSF is known for beeing falsely recognized as threat by several anti virus programs. Try deactivating your AV-software. EDIT: Go to Control Panel->Adminstrative Tools->Event Viewer->Windows-Protocols->Applications and Control Panel->Adminstrative Tools->Event Viewer->Windows-Protocols->System and check for error messages that involve the Shock Force exe. There must be an accurate error message in the Event Viewer and once you have found it, you can fix it. Schrullenhaft Posted April 2, 2015 Share Posted April 2, 2015 This may be an issue due to DEP (Data Execution Prevention). The copy-protection system for CMSF is different from all of the other CMx2 games where it is using eLicense. Hopefully this Knowledgebase article will get you running: "0xc0000005" error As agusto mentioned, your anti-virus/security software can also play a part. You may want to add exceptions for EACH game executable (the main game and the 'module' executable files). 0 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Schrullenhaft Posted April 6, 2015 Share Posted April 6, 2015 I forgot one more file that needs to have a DEP exception set for it is 'Runservice.exe' in the 'Windows' directory. This file will be present after you have successfully activated the game on the computer (and not before, unless you've activated another eLicense game). 0 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
